To solve a rational inequality, you first find the zeroes (from the numerator) and the undefined points (from the denominator). You use these zeroes and undefined points to divide the number line into intervals.

Q. Solve and graph the solution set: 2x/(x+1)≥1

You cannot multiply both sides of the inequality by x+1 to eliminate the fraction. This is because we do not know whether x+1 is negative or positive; therefore, we do not know whether we would need to reverse the direction of the inequality.
